
Bubbling fruit, a golden nutty crust, and the kind of aroma that makes everyone wander into the kitchen ā this mixed berry crumble delivers all of that with a completely clean ingredient list. Every component is naturally free of added flavor enhancers, so what you taste is exactly what went in: ripe berries brightened with lemon juice and warm cinnamon, sweetened only with maple syrup. The crumble topping comes together from almond flour, raw sliced almonds, coconut oil, and a pinch of sea salt, which bakes into a deeply golden, satisfyingly crunchy layer that holds its own against the jammy, bubbling filling underneath. Tapioca starch does quiet but important work here, thickening the berry juices into a glossy, spoonable sauce as the dish cools. It's the kind of dessert that looks impressive straight from the baking dish but genuinely couldn't be simpler to pull off. Serve it warm and let the filling set for a few minutes ā that brief rest makes all the difference between a saucy puddle and a perfectly scoopable crumble.

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9-inch baking dish with a small amount of coconut oil.
In a large mixing bowl, combine the mixed berries, 2 tbsp maple syrup, tapioca starch, lemon juice, and 1/4 tsp cinnamon. Stir until the berries are evenly coated and the starch is fully dissolved. Pour the filling into the prepared baking dish and spread into an even layer.
